Temperature and pressure: how weather and seasons affect readings
Temperature plays a pivotal role in tire pressure. In cold weather, air contracts and pressure drops; in hot weather, pressure rises as air expands. The difference can be several psi between morning and afternoon checks. For accurate readings, you should check tires after they have cooled for at least 3 hours or 1-2 hours in mild climates before driving. If you must check after a drive, use the reading as a historical data point rather than a current target—allow the tires to return to ambient temperature before making adjustments. Tools and calibration: gauges, TPMS, and vehicle specs
Tools matter when measuring tire pressure. Use a high-quality gauge, and stick with the same gauge for consistency. Your vehicle’s door jamb sticker or the owner’s manual lists the recommended cold psi for each tire. If you use TPMS, remember it’s a warning system and not a substitute for manual checks. TPMS can miss gradual leaks or show false alerts when tires are suddenly heated from driving. After adding or removing air, recheck with your gauge to confirm accuracy. Tires also have a maximum pressure rating on the sidewall; never exceed this limit, even on a hot day. Common mistakes and how to avoid them
Even experienced drivers make errors when checking tire pressure. The most frequent problem is measuring hot tires immediately after driving, which yields inflated readings. Another mistake is using a worn gauge or relying solely on TPMS without manual verification. Some drivers overinflate because they’re chasing higher numbers; others underinflate to save fuel and risk wear or blowouts. The safest practice is to measure cold tires with a reliable gauge, compare to the vehicle’s official spec, and adjust in small, safe increments. If you’re unsure, remeasure after the tires have cooled and keep a log to track trends.

Steps
Estimated time: 15-20 minutes
- 1
Gather tools
Collect a reliable tire pressure gauge, a source of air, and your vehicle’s PSI specification before you begin to ensure an accurate measurement.
Tip: Verify gauge accuracy against a known-accurate reference if possible. - 2
Check tires are cold
Ensure tires haven’t been driven recently; wait at least 3 hours after driving or perform measurement early in the day.
Tip: Cold tires provide stable readings and prevent inflated numbers. - 3
Remove valve caps
Take off each valve stem cap and set it aside so you have access to the valve for measurement.
Tip: Keep caps clean and track them so you don’t lose them. - 4
Attach gauge and take readings
Press the gauge onto the valve stem firmly and read the PSI. Repeat on all four tires for consistency.
Tip: If the gauge reads zero, re-seat and retry to ensure a proper seal. - 5
Compare to spec and adjust
Compare each reading with the recommended PSI; adjust in small increments using an air compressor until you’re within the target range.
Tip: Make small adjustments (1-2 psi at a time) to avoid overinflation. - 6
Recheck and recap
Recheck all tires after adjustments and reinstall valve caps securely.
Tip: Record readings to monitor trends over time.
Frequently Asked Questions
Why should tires be cold when measuring pressure?
Measuring cold tires yields the most accurate PSI because driving heats air and raises readings. A cold measurement reduces false inflation and helps you set the correct target.

Can I measure pressure after driving?
You can measure after driving, but treat the result as a historical data point. The reading will be higher due to heat, so don’t adjust based on a hot measurement.
